Output 58f3f6c4da32d420788a47d8331423206e12c128ea4c180368bca558ff066425:0
- value
- 75000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aed784a6b5c4544db56d4d2666862280fbf0b9a1 OP_EQUAL
- address
- 3HdVgPQaFzCdFYf278CHfjfFgK9eXgzpc3
- transaction
- 58f3f6c4da32d420788a47d8331423206e12c128ea4c180368bca558ff066425
- spent
- true